Game Recap: Men's Lacrosse |

Griffins Hold Off Eagles to Clinch #2 Seed and Home Playoff Game

The Chestnut Hill College Men's Lacrosse team held off a late rally from host Post University Wednesday afternoon, defeating the eagles, 9-8  at LaMoy field in Waterbury, Connecticut.

With the win, the Griffins clinch the #2 seed for the upcoming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ference Men's Lacrosse Championship and a first round bye.  The Griffins will host #3 seed University of Bridgeport at victory Field #1 on Wednesday, April 29.

The Griffins improved to 8-4 overall and finished the regular season with an 8-1 conference record.  The Eagles finish 5-3 in league play and are 9-6 overall.

Jake Ballerini led the Griffins, tallying four points on two goals and two assists.  Preston Page and Matthew Miller also had two goals apiece.

Silas Charles led Chestnut Hill with four caused turnovers with Daniel Myers adding three.  Aidan Walsh, Miller and Aidan Owens had four ground balls apiece.  Adam Daley made 17 saves in goal in the winning effort.

The Griffins held a three-goal lead with just 1:09 left in the game when Eagles rallied to score twice in the final minute of action scoring with 47 seconds left and then again with just 17 seconds left to pull within one 9-8.  Ther Eagles won the ensuing faceoff in the final seconds, but Charles caused a turnover as time was about to expire to seal the win.

Chestnut Hill never trailed in the contest, jumping out to a 2-0 lead in the first quarter via goals from Will Duddy and Miller.  The Eagles Leighton Cooke scored the first of his five goals with 1:24 left in the opening period to pull the hosts within one 2-1.

Goals from Charles Cox and Page in the second quarter increased the Griffins lead to 4-1.  The Eagles again closed to one with two more goals from Cooke before halftime, cutting CHC's lead to 4-3 at the break.

Ballerini had the first of his two goals at the 8:49 mark of the third quarter with Cox getting the assist on the play to make the score 5-3.  The Eagles had another two gals to tie the game at 5-5 before Ballerini put the Griffins back on top 6-5.  Cooke tallied his fifth goal of the game with just under a minute remaining, tying the score again at 6-6 as both teams headed into the final period.

Chestnut Hill score three unanswered goals, first by Page  followed by Miller.  Cole Pedroso scored the Griffins' final goal with 1:09 left to give CHC a 9-6 lead before the eagles started their rally which fell just short.

The men's lacrosse team will play on Wednesday, April 29, 2026 at victory field, hosting the #3 seed University of Bridgeport in the CACC Semi Finals.
